KIOXIA PM7-V Series 24G SAS Enterprise SSD is optimized for mixed use applications, including relational database, streaming media, data warehousing and web services. The series is designed to deliver balanced levels of performance, reliability, capacity and endurance for mixed use and read intensive environments.

Featuring KIOXIA 112-layer BiCS FLASH™ 3D flash memory, this 7th generation enterprise SAS SSD PM7-V offers 3 DWPD (Drive Writes Per Day) with capacities up to 12.8 TB.

Key Features

  • 24G SAS interface with single/dual-port support
  • Capacities from 1.6 TB to 12.8 TB
  • Up to 720K random read IOPS (4 KiB) in dual-port mode
  • 2.5-inch form factor, 15 mm thickness
  • 3 DWPD with 100 % Random Write Workload
  • Power Loss Protection and End-to-End Data Protection, including T10 DIF
  • Security options: SIE, SED, FIPS SED
  • 5-year limited warranty
